Day 3: Running of the bulls. Tuesday July 7.
Ready set GO! Today we are running in front of bulls that have been let loose on a course of the town's streets, (or watching safety from the sidelines) as the mayhem unfolds before our very eyes. Injuries are common to the participants who may be gored or trampled, so be warned this is not for the faint hearted. The purpose of this event originally was the transport of the bulls from the off-site corrals where they had spent the night, to the bullring where they would be killed in the evening.
